Ukraine says the 'old days' of trust are over | Starmer is to meet Trump for talks next week
VOLODYMYR Zelensky is urging Europe to raise its own army, warning that the continent cannot rely on the US for its defence.
As G7 foreign ministers yesterday agreed to keep pursuing a strong peace deal for Ukraine, Prime Minister Keir Starmer confirmed he would travel to New York to meet US President Donald Trump next week.
Mr Trump announced this week he will hold talks with Russian president Vladimir Putin in Saudi Arabia.
He will send senior officials including national security adviser Mike Waltz, Secretary of State Marco Rubio and Middle East envoy Steve Witkoff to Riyadh in the coming days. UK officials believe that Mr Starmer's meeting with Trump could be key to determining the direction those talks take.But Mr Zelensky swore: "Ukraine will never accept deals made behind our backs without our involvement."
It comes as Ukraine's president told the Munich Security Conference, where G7 leaders including UK Foreign Secretary David Lammy and Defence Secretary John Healey gathered over the weekend, that the "old days" of guaranteed US support "were over".
Mr Zelensky said: "We can't rule out the possibility that America might say no to Europe on issues that threaten it."
He warned that "some in Europe may not fully understand what's happening in Washington right now" and urged "giving strength to Europe first".
